Best way to open:

There is a high chance that the champagne cork will injure someone as it rapidly pops out of the bottleneck. So to make everyone safe make sure to keep the cage on! The cage will help control the cork from flying and provide leverage to help the cork separate from the bottle. To keep the cork in the palace, hold the cage on top of the cork with your thumb. It would help if you twisted the wire six times to remove the cork. You need to use both hands, one to hold the cage and cork together and the other to twist the bottle's base in a circular direction. Twist the base in a circular direction away from the cork to get the cork out.

Where to store:

For most people, The most common place to store a champagne bottle is to store it in the fridge. It is perfect as long as you are going to drink it within 3 or 4 days of buying it. But if you plan to drink it later, you must keep it in a cool and dark place with a consistent temperature. Cooling from the fridge can dry the cork, further enhancing the oxidizing process that leads to the aroma changes.

The ideal temperature:

A bottle of champagne is usually served cold at around 50⁰ F. temperature. The best way to cool the bottle is by storing it in an ice bucket with one-third of water, and It can drop the temperature in 15-20 minutes.

Pouring:

Champagne is different from any other drink as you will relish it for a long time. You only filled a wine glass about one-third. Over-pouring can warm the wine very quickly, and it will lose its aroma and taste after getting warm.
